Unless you know alot about cryptography, security and related programming
you should not start writing your own software. It's only foolish beginning
writing your own when it'll be more limited, less secure then any existing
solution. Most people don't realise that a poor license manager can actually
cripple the way you want to sell your software and your users. It's been
seen many times.
There are many solutions for many different problem. Overall if you want to
proceed you should consider going with something which uses asymetric
cryptography, offers flexibility for you to incorporate new license models
in future so you don't find yourself in a situation in 9 months that you're
unable to deliver to customer demands because of the license management.
